アーキテクチャ設計プロセスにおけるコード分析はどのように行われますか?

コード分​​析は、アーキテクチャ設計プロセスの重要な部分です。これは、コードを検査してエラー、バグ、脆弱性を特定し、コードが意図したとおりに動作することを確認するのに役立ちます。アーキテクチャ設計プロセスでコード分析がどのように実行されるかに関するいくつかの手順を次に示します。

1. 計画: 実際の分析の前に、正確に何を分析する必要があるか、分析を実行するためにどのツールを使用するか、および誰が分析を実行するかを決定する計画が必要です。プロセスに責任を持ちます。

2. ツールの選択: コード分析に適切なツールを選択することが重要です。コード分​​析用の一般的なツールには、SonarQube、FindBugs、PMD などがあります。

3. コード レビュー: 次に、コードをレビューして、コード内に存在するエラー、バグ、または脆弱性を確認します。これは、選択したツールを使用してコードをスキャンして潜在的な問題を見つけることによって行われます。

4. バグ修正: エラーが特定されたら、次のステップはそれらを修正することです。開発者はコードを変更して問題を解決し、コードの品質を確保します。

5. 再テスト: コードが修正された後、問題が解決されていることを確認するために再テストされます。

6. 文書化: 文書化は、検出されたエラーとコードに加えられた変更を追跡するため、プロセスの重要な部分です。

コード分​​析は、開発サイクル全体を通じてコードの品質を維持するのに役立つため、継続的なプロセスです。定期的にコード分析を実施することで、開発者は問題を早期に発見し、コーディング スキルを向上させ、コードが可能な限り最高の品質であることを保証できます。

発行日: